The mark of "Dat Mui" at Thu Dat Viet space

Participating in the Fair in the "Thu Dat Viet" subdivision, Ca Mau booth stood out with the theme "Ca Mau - Forest scent, sea taste" and "Ca Mau - Southernmost land of the Fatherland", expressing the unique identity of the southernmost land.

On an exhibition area of ​​200 m², Ca Mau introduced more than 100 typical, distinctive and OCOP products of 26 enterprises, cooperatives and production facilities. In particular, the main seafood group including shrimp, crab and processed products - the leading strength of the province - stood out.

Vice Chairman of the Provincial People's Committee Huynh Chi Nguyen said that participating in the fair is an opportunity for businesses and cooperatives to promote products, expand markets, connect trade, attract investment and transfer technology; at the same time, spread the cultural, culinary and eco-tourism values ​​of Ca Mau.

The province's exhibition space is highly appreciated for its professionalism and creativity, highlighted by symbolic miniatures such as Ca Mau Cape, national coordinate landmark, Ca Mau crab model, wind power field, and freshwater ecosystem. The province also promotes the 2nd Ca Mau Crab Festival in 2025, creating a vivid highlight.

During the inspection of the event activities, Deputy Prime Minister Bui Thanh Son, Head of the Fair Steering Committee, highly appreciated the preparation work and beautiful and diverse product designs of the Ca Mau booth.

Positive signals from product connection and consumption

After only the first three days (October 26-28), Ca Mau's booth at the 2025 Autumn Fair recorded many positive results, showing clear effectiveness in trade promotion and local product promotion.

During this time, the booth welcomed about 22,000 visitors and shoppers, with a total estimated revenue of 670 million VND. On the opening day alone (October 26), the number of visitors reached more than 10,000, the highest revenue - 300 million VND, and recorded the first commercial contract between Thuy Luc Facility (An Xuyen Ward) and Le Phuong Import Export Company (Ha Tinh).

In the following days, in addition to maintaining a stable number of customers and revenue, intensive trade promotion activities were promoted. Notably, on October 28, Ca Mau units such as Ba Khia Dam Doi Cooperative, Quach Tet Company, and Huong Rung Ecological Agriculture Cooperative successfully connected with major distribution systems including Central Retail Vietnam and Aeon Vietnam, and established many other potential trade cooperation agreements.

Many businesses have also opened up the export of products to the Chinese market through e-commerce platforms such as Taobao, 1688 and Douyin. Ca Mau's key products - dried shrimp, shrimp crackers, dried fish, frozen shrimp, bird's nest, are continuously among the top-selling products at the Fair.

The unit with the leading revenue is Ngoc Giau Seafood Production and Trading Company Limited, reaching nearly 200 million VND, contributing to highlighting the brand "Ca Mau - Forest scent, sea taste" in the national fair space.

From promotion to upgrading production capacity

The fair not only opens up business opportunities but also encourages production facilities to improve capacity and standardize processes to meet new market demands.

Thuy Luc facility, with its 4-star OCOP fish sauce beef product, is investing in additional equipment and expanding its production scale to serve new partners. Many other cooperatives and businesses such as Huong Rung Cooperative and Ngoc Giau Company have also signed a series of long-term consumption cooperation agreements with businesses in Hanoi and the North.

According to the Department of Industry and Trade of Ca Mau province, the 2025 Autumn Fair is an important opportunity to expand the trade network, connect large distribution systems and investors, and contribute to enhancing the brand of local goods.

FALL FAIR 1ST/2025

Time: From October 26 to November 4, 2025

Location: Kim Quy Exhibition House, Hanoi

Scale: Nearly 3,000 domestic and foreign booths, divided into 5 zones.

Main subdivisions:

“Thu Thinh Vuong” - Honoring industrial strength, gathering leading corporations in Vietnam.

“Family Autumn” - Introducing fashion, cosmetics, interior and consumer goods products.

“Autumn of Vietnam” and “Quintessence of Autumn in Hanoi” - the “Heart” of the fair, converging the cultural - economic - tourism quintessence of 34 provinces and cities.

Direction & organization: Under the direction of the Prime Minister, the Ministry of Industry and Trade is assigned to preside over and coordinate with the Ministry of Culture, Sports and Tourism, Hanoi People's Committee and relevant ministries, branches and localities to implement.
